Carrot & Chocolate Chip Sheet Cake (18 x 13 Pan or a Half Sheet Pan)

​Prep time: 20 minutes ​Bake time: 20–25 minutes ​Yield: 24–30 square slices

​Ingredients

​For the Sheet Cake:

Dry Ingredients: •2 ½ cups all-purpose flour (minus 1 tsp to toss with the chocolate chips) •2 tsp baking soda •1 tsp baking powder •1 tbsp ground cinnamon •½ tsp ground nutmeg •1 tsp salt

Wet Ingredients: •​1 cup granulated sugar •​1 cup dark or light brown sugar, packed •​1 cup + 1 tbsp vegetable or canola oil (the extra tablespoon covers the applesauce adjustment) •​½ Cup unsweetened applesauce •​4 large eggs, room temperature •​2 tsp vanilla extract

•​3 ½ cups finely grated fresh carrots (about 4 large or 5–6 medium carrots, processed with your fine shredding disc) •​1 cup mini semi-sweet or dark chocolate chips (plus the added tsp of Flour)

​For the Cream Cheese Frosting: •​8 oz (1 block) cream cheese, softened to room temperature •​½ c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ature •​1 ½ tsp vanilla extract •​Pinch of salt

•​3 ½ to 4 cups powdered sugar •​1–2 tbsp milk or heavy cream (if needed to thin for easy spreading)

​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). ​Lightly grease your 18x13-inch jelly roll pan. Line the bottom with parchment paper and spray again.

  2. ​In a small bowl, toss the 1 cup of mini chocolate chips with 1 teaspoon of the flour until lightly coated. Set aside. •1 Cup Mini Chocolate Chips •1 tsp. Flour

​3. ​In a large bowl, whisk together the remaining flour,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. •2 ½ cups all-purpose flour (minus 1 tsp to toss with the chocolate chips) •2 tsp baking soda •1 tsp baking powder •1 tbsp ground cinnamon •½ tsp ground nutmeg •1 tsp salt

  1. ​In a separate bowl, whisk together the granulated sugar, brown sugar, oil, the applesauce, eggs, and vanilla extract until completely smooth. •​1 cup granulated sugar •​1 cup dark or light brown sugar, packed •​1 cup + 1 tbsp vegetable or canola oil (the extra tablespoon covers the applesauce adjustment) •​½ cup unsweetened applesauce •​4 large eggs, room temperature •​2 tsp vanilla extract

  2. ​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and gently fold with a spatula just until combined (do not overmix).

  3. ​Gently fold in the 3 ½ cups of finely shredded carrots. Right after, fold in the flour-coated mini chocolate chips until evenly distributed throughout the batter. ​

  4. ​Pour the batter into your prepared pan and spread it evenly into the corners with a spatula.

  5. ​Bake for 20 to 25 minutes at 350°F.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ean, and the top should spring back when lightly pressed. ​Cool completely before frosting.

​Making the Frosting:

  1. Beat the softened cream cheese and butter together with a mixer on medium speed for 2–3 minutes until fluffy and smooth. ​Mix in the vanilla extract and a pinch of salt. •​8 oz (1 block) cream cheese, softened to room temperature •​½ c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ature •​1 ½ tsp vanilla extract •Pinch of Salt

  2. ​Gradually add the powdered sugar, 1 cup at a time, mixing on low until combined. Increase speed to high for 1 minute until smooth. If it feels too stiff to spread smoothly over a thin sheet cake, blend in 1 tablespoon of milk or cream. •​3 ½ to 4 cups powdered sugar •​1–2 tbsp milk or heavy cream (if needed to thin for easy spreading)

  3. ​Spread the frosting evenly over the cooled cake, slice into squares, and serve!
